| Unfortunately this has been deprecated in Vista. (and i do mean unfortunately)
You have really only one option.
If you run Vista Business, Ultimate, or Enterprise you can do the following:
1. Click the orb, in search bar type in gpedit.msc, open it when search finds it.
2. Click ok for the UAC prompt.
3. Under Computer Configuration (left pane) , expand Windows Settings.
4. Under Windows Settings expand Security Settings.
5. Under Security Settings, expand Local Policies.
6. Under local policies select Security Options.
7. In the right-pane, scroll down to Interactive Logon: Do not display last username.
8. Double click it and change it to Enabled.
9. Click ok, and close gpedit.msc
This will force EVERY user to always type in a username and password, the user icons will no longer display in a list on the logon page.
If you have Home Basic, or Home Premium do the following:
1. Click the Orb
2. In the search box type regedit and press Enter.
3. Click Continue for UAC prompt.
4. In regedit, go to: H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Policies\System
5. In the right pane, right click on dontdisplaylastusername and click Modify.
6. To Enable Username and Password Logon -Type 1 and click OK. (See screenshot below)
7. To Restore the Default Logon - Type 0 (number zero) and click OK.
8. Close regedit.
The next time you go to a logon screen, you will be required to enter your username and password to logon to Vista for your user account.
